IDF Soldiers Mistakenly Shoot and Kill Three Hostages in Gaza Strip: Official Reports from Israel Defense Forces

2023-12-15 20:46:10

IDF soldiers mistakenly shot and killed three hostages in the Gaza Strip. reports December 15 official telegram channel of the Israel Defense Forces.

“During the battle in Shejaiya, the IDF mistakenly identified three Israeli hostages as posing a threat. As a result, the soldiers opened fire on them and they were killed,” the IDF said in a statement.

All three were identified. Two were among those kidnapped during the Hamas attack on October 7. The family of the third victim asked the military not to disclose information about the deceased, clarifies RBC.

The IDF “expresses deep remorse” for the tragic incident and “sends its sincere condolences to the families.”

According to Israel, there are about 130 more hostages in the Gaza Strip.

Let us remind you that the Palestinian-Israeli conflict escalated on October 7. The Hamas group launched a large-scale rocket attack on Israel from the Gaza Strip, Hamas fighters infiltrated the border areas and took hostages. In response, the Israel Defense Forces launched Operation Iron Swords in the Gaza Strip. In November, the parties temporarily ceased fire; the agreement lasted from November 24 to December 1. Then the fighting began again, which was called perhaps the most violent of the entire war.

According to the latest Israeli data, 1,200 Israelis have been killed since October 7. The Palestinian Ministry of Health reports 18.6 thousand dead in Gaza.
